Resonance of Hot Sand: Haruomi Hosono’s Music Drift

1990 · 59 min Documentary

A documentary that aired on January 20, 1990, on NHK General TV. This program focuses on the renowned Japanese musician Haruomi Hosono and his diverse musical journey, capturing various aspects of his creative process and collaborations.
